Oliver Sykes’ Dad Joined Bring Me The Horizon On Stage To Perform ‘Antivist’

Eva van den Bosch
Eva van den Bosch
June 24, 2024 One Min Read

Last weekend, at their headliner spot, Bring Me The Horizon brought out a very special guest to join them for their performance of Antivist.

Frontman Oliver Sykes‘ dad, Ian Sykes, came walking on stage to perform the 2013 Sempiternal track. “Help him out – he’s a little nervous… Make some noise for the coolest dad in the world!”, Oli said.

Throughout this year, Bring Me The Horizon have elevated their live performances of Antivist with various guest appearances. Notable moments include Bad Omens’ Noah Sebastian joining them during their January UK tour and Sleep Token’s IV performing with them in Australia.
